Hi
I've managed to configure a script which hangs the N900 whenever I load Desktop-Cmd-Exec. I cant get to edit the script because I hang the N900 as soon as I go to the desktop. No problem, I thought to myself, simply do an apt-get purge and all traces of the app will be gone. Then re-install and start again. Unfortunately this does not appear to remove the config files as whenever I re-install it, my rogue script is still there so the N900 hangs again.

Can anybody tell me where the config file lives so that I can delete it and start all over again?
 
nicolai's Avatar
Posts: 1,637 | Thanked: 4,424 times | Joined on Apr 2009 @ Germany
#373
Originally Posted by wildherb View Post
Can anybody tell me where the config file lives so that I can delete it and start all over again?
/home/user/.desktop_cmd_exec

Hey, this is a great app.
But I also want to use DCEW as buttons as described in the wiki. I want to avoid lock/unlock-loops and so on, so what exactly must I do with my other widgets' settings? Is there a general command to disable any update method but "on clicking" or do I have to check all my widgets one by one?
How have you done it before you used DCEW as buttons?

I think there is too little explanation/useful advice to avoid the problems in the wiki... This thread shows that many users came to have this problems...

Would be really glad if you helped me!

Thanks!
 
Posts: 1,680 | Thanked: 3,685 times | Joined on Jan 2011
#377
the DCEW options for each individual 'instance' (widget) must be set. To use them as buttons (as I do) set them to ONLY update when pressed. (i.e switch off autoupdate, screen change update, update on boot and ignore network connection update).
